Benamayer said:
Yes I will tonight.. Tank looks exactly the same lol, I'll post some though! I'm considering removing the media sponge that is slotted, and running ONLY the media bags... Good idea?

If you can throw a few pieces of rock or rubble where the sponge is you may see some nice copepod action going on in there. It would also pull double duty as natural filtration media. Some shops sell scrap live rock rubble for pretty cheap. Just throwing out an option. Leaving the bags is definitely a good thing. I replaced the carbon bag for a 100ml bag of Purigen in my daughter's Spec 5 but it's a planted FW tank. If you remove the sponge you would have room for both.
